After I left the entertainment industry, I became a philosophy and history teacher at a college.

In my classes we read Tolstoy, William Golding, Judith Jarvis Thomson, Peter Singer…

My students loved Tolstoy, and I remember showing up to class, and students not even enrolled in the course would be sitting against the walls to listen and join the discussion.

Reading all those stories, essays and having young, bright minds ask profound questions was an education in and of itself.
